What You Will Do
Soar over the west Maui rainforest and the north shore of Molokaʻi to view the sea cliffs and waterfalls. Head back over West maui to our amazing Oceanfront Landing location to take in the views. Once done at the landing location the pilot will take back off and continue the tour back to the Kahului Heliport.

- Weight Restrictions: Due to FAA regulations, all passengers must be weighed at check-in. For each single passenger weighing 240 pounds or more, combined weights of 420 lbs per couple, or for groups of 3 or more an average weight of 200lbs or more an additional seat must be purchased at time of booking. This is for the safety and comfort of all passengers. It is important to provide accurate body weight at checkout.
- It is recommended that all passengers wear dark clothing to help have less reflection in the windows when flying and therefore you can get better photos during your tour
